1. Set Clear Goals and Prioritize Areas

Establish specific decluttering goals and prioritize which areas of your home need the most attention.

2. Utilize Multi-Functional Furniture

Maximize space and reduce clutter by incorporating furniture with built-in storage or dual-purpose functionality.

3. Implement the KonMari Method

Follow Marie Kondo's renowned method of decluttering by sorting items by category and keeping only those that spark joy.

4. Digitize and Declutter Paperwork

Reduce paper clutter by digitizing important documents and setting up a system for organizing and discarding paperwork.

5. Embrace Minimalism

Adopt a minimalist mindset by focusing on owning fewer possessions and prioritizing quality over quantity.

6. Invest in Smart Storage Solutions

Utilize innovative storage solutions such as modular shelving, under-bed storage, and closet organizers to maximize space.

7. Create Daily Habits for Maintenance

Incorporate daily habits like putting items back in their designated places to maintain a clutter-free home.

8. Declutter Sentimental Items Mindfully

Approach sentimental items with thoughtfulness, keeping only those that hold significant meaning and letting go of the rest.

9. Regularly Purge and Donate Unwanted Items

Regularly assess and purge items that no longer serve a purpose, and donate them to those in need.

10. Seek Professional Help if Needed

Consider hiring a professional organizer or decluttering service if you feel overwhelmed or unable to tackle the task on your own.
